What is an OEM recovery partition?

OEM partition is designed for systemrecovery or factory restore. It allows users toeasily and quickly restore the system to the original statewhen system failure or system crash occurs. This partitionusually comes with Dell, Lenovo, or HP computer.

Regarding this, what is the OEM partition used for?

The System Reserved partition is createdautomatically while Windows is installing. It contains boot data.The OEM partition is the manufacturer's (Dell etc.) recoverypartition. It's used when you restore/reinstallWindows with the OEM disk or from bios.

Just so, what is a healthy recovery partition?

Recovery partition is a special partitionon system hard drive and is used to restore thesystem to factory settings in the event of system issues. TypicallyWindows recovery partition only takes up several hundred MBdisk space, as it only contains the bare operatingsystem.

Is EFI system partition needed?

As mentioned before, the EFI partition isessential for the installed OS on the hard disk. However, for anexternal hard drive, you do not actually need the EFIpartition. Some users had the EFI partition created on aMac, and now they want to install Windows to replace MacOS.

Can OEM partition be deleted?

OEM partition is designed for system recovery orfactory restore. And some people want to delete OEMpartitions to extend more space since they don't plan to restorethe device to factory setting. Then a problem comes out. WindowsDisk Management tool doesn't support to remove the OEMpartition.

What is the primary partition?

Definition of: primary partition. primarypartition. A reserved part of a Windows disk, which isidentified by a drive letter. The entire C: drive is often oneprimary partition; however, multiple partitions arecreated for a user's own organizational purposes or for bootinginto different operating systems.

Can I delete ESP partition?

Deleting EFI system partition will causeinstalled systems unbootable. So, EFI systempartition is usually protected and locked by the Windowsoperating systems to prevent and avoid accidental deletion of thesepartitions. That's why you can't delete EFIpartition using the Disk Management tool.

What is a GPT partition style?

The maximum size of each partition on MBR diskcannot exceed 2TB. GPT partition style is newer standard fordisk partitioning, which defines partition structureby GUID (Globally Unique Identifiers). GPT is part ofUEFI standard, which means UEFI-based system should be installed onGPT disk.

Can I delete WinRE partition?

Removing the currently enabled Recovery(WinRE) partition from a GPT disk is not recommended.The partition is a hidden NTFS (type 27) partitionand is treated as a special partition by Windows. Forexample, Disk Management will not allow assigning a driveletter or deleting the partition.

How do I remove a protected partition?

HOW TO REMOVE STUCK PARTITIONS:
  1. Bring up a CMD or PowerShell window (as an administrator)
  2. Type DISKPART and press enter.
  3. Type LIST DISK and press enter.
  4. Type SELECT DISK <n> and press enter.
  5. Type LIST PARTITION and press enter.
  6. Type SELECT PARTITION <n> and press enter.
  7. Type DELETE PARTITION OVERRIDE and press enter.

How do I get rid of HP recovery partition Windows 10?

Click Start, right-click Computer, and then select theManage option. In the left panel of the Computer Managementwindow, double-click Storage to expand the options. clickDisk Management to display a list of partitions, also calledVolumes. Right-click the Recovery partition (D:), and selectthe Delete Volume option.
